Location: State College, PA (Onsite) Compensation: $25-$27/hr. Travel: 75% overnight (weekdays only)
Wright Technical Services is representing a rapidly growing, employee-owned organization within the life sciences and biotech services space. This company supports pharmaceutical, biotech, hospital, and research environments by ensuring the accuracy, compliance, and reliability of critical laboratory and medical equipment.
This is a unique opportunity to join a high-growth organization offering equity ownership, strong benefits, and significant long-term career advancement. The team is seeking an ambitious and customer-focused Calibration Process Manager to support clients across the region while building strong technical and professional relationships.
Responsibilities
Build and maintain strong customer relationships across healthcare, biotech, and research environments, ranging from technicians to executive stakeholders
Perform calibration, troubleshooting, and repair of laboratory and biomedical instrumentation (oscilloscopes, analyzers, electro-mechanical systems, etc.)
Ensure accuracy and compliance of equipment used in critical research, development, and patient care applications
Develop and document calibration procedures, test methods, and service reports as needed
Interpret technical documentation and follow detailed calibration processes with precision
Travel to client sites (weekday overnight travel) to support field service and calibration activities
Represent the organization as a professional, high-value service provider in all customer interactions
Proactively identify issues, troubleshoot effectively, and follow through to resolution
